I am currently working on setting up a new mirror, I have started the rsync and it appears to be working you can find the site at http://70.168.40.244/CentOS/ I am working on the ftp but for some reason it will not let windows explorer connect from the browser only if I use a FTP program...
I was wondering if someone could help??? I'm using vsftpd and I have anonymous_enable=YES anon_root=/var/ftp/CentOS/ dirlist_enable=YES no_anon_password=yes
Well,
Probably has to do with active / passive mode FTP.
You need a few lines in the iptables to allow the passive ports, and then you also need the _pasv config lines in the vsftpd.conf file...
Shane.
---------------- /etc/sysconfig/iptables ...
-A RH-Lokkit-0-50-INPUT -p tcp -m tcp --dport 21 --tcp-flags SYN,RST,ACK SYN -j ACCEPT -A RH-Lokkit-0-50-INPUT -p udp -m udp --dport 21 -j ACCEPT -A RH-Lokkit-0-50-INPUT -p tcp -m tcp --dport 49152:65534 --tcp-flags SYN,RST,ACK SYN -j ACCEPT
----------------- part of my centos config for vsftp -------- anonymous_enable=YES listen=yes listen_address=1.2.3.4 dual_log_enable=yes background=yes hide_ids=yes ftp_username=ftpcentos one_process_model=yes session_support=no
connect_from_port_20=YES setproctitle_enable=YES max_clients=700 max_per_ip=2 banner_file=/etc/vsftpd.banner pasv_max_port=65534 pasv_min_port=49152
